dressed的意思

dressed


英式读音
英式读音

  • adj.穿着衣服;穿着…服装
  • v.“dress”的过去分词和过去式
  • 网络熟皮;表衣着情况;打扮好的

近义词

    adj.turned out,garbed

反义词

    adj.undressed

权威英汉双解

    Hurry up and get dressed .

    快点穿上衣服。

    fully dressed

    穿戴整齐的

    I can't go to the door─I'm not dressed yet.

    我没法去开门,我还没穿好衣服呢。

    smartly dressed

    衣着讲究

    The bride was dressed in white.

    新娘身穿白色礼服。

    He was casually dressed in jeans and a T-shirt.

    他穿着很随便的牛仔裤和 T 恤衫。

英汉释义

  • v.

    1.“dress”的过去分词和过去式

英英释义

  • adj.

    1.wearing clothes of a particular type

    2.someone who is dressed is wearing clothes

  • v.

    1.The past participle and past tense of dress
